4126.6 Determinants <strong>of</strong> group perceptions and core values <strong>of</strong> students from five cultural<br />

heritage groups in South Africa, Martin J.L. Jooste, Ingrid Wagendorp, Department <strong>of</strong><br />

<strong>Psychology</strong>, University <strong>of</strong> Johannesburg, South Africa<br />

Aim: Exploring the impact <strong>of</strong> certain variables on South African undergraduates' core values and<br />

perceptions <strong>of</strong> five cultural orientation groups. Sample: <strong>Psychology</strong> undergraduate volunteers<br />

identifying with a Western (Afrikaans: n= 138, English: n= 187), African (n=151), Middle Eastern<br />

(Muslim) (n= 0), or Asian (Indian) (n= 61) heritage (N= 541). Measures: A local Semantic<br />

Differential attitude scale (S/D), Individualism/Collectivism (I /C) scale and biographical<br />

questionnaire. A survey design was utilized that also included analyzing the psychometric<br />

properties <strong>of</strong> the scales, correlations, ANOVAs and post-hoc comparison tests. Findings: Gender,<br />

residence type, cultural identity and first language influenced S/D and I/C scores.<br />

4126.7 The stability <strong>of</strong> social axioms and values across the Hong Kong SARS outbreak period,<br />

Johanna H.W. Lai, Natalie H.H. Hui, M.H. Bond, The Chinese University <strong>of</strong> Hong Kong, Hong<br />

Kong, China<br />

Leung and Bond (2003) proposed a pan-cultural, five-factor structure <strong>of</strong> social axioms (SA) as a<br />

complementary system to Schwartz’s (1992) value circumplex in predicting behaviors. However,<br />

the stability <strong>of</strong> social axioms is yet to be established. The present paper presents a longitudinal<br />

study in Hong Kong, comparing the stability <strong>of</strong> SA and values. Findings suggest that the<br />

dimensions <strong>of</strong> SA are even more stable than that <strong>of</strong> value in a one-year pre-post test, despite the<br />

outbreak <strong>of</strong> SARS during the year as a natural mortality-inducing event. Influence <strong>of</strong> SA and<br />

values to coping styles and emotional response were also explored.<br />

4126.8 Examination <strong>of</strong> work values among Japanese youths, Xin Du, Keio University, Japan<br />

This paper questions the traditional view <strong>of</strong> Japanese work ethic through interview with Japanese<br />

youths. The traditional work ethic <strong>of</strong> Japanese, which is characterized by strong work motivation,<br />

group solidarity, and loyalty to their organizations, has indeed been affected by drastic changes in<br />

Japanese society. Instead, the interviews show how the youths' work ethic combines both<br />

traditional values and a new stress on individuality and independent self-realization in the choice<br />

<strong>of</strong> job and career. This research attempts to highlight the young people's changing believes and<br />

attitudes towards life and work in particular, as well as their hopes for the future.<br />
